Subject: Key rotation following the Glintquery N+1 fix

Team — as part of the Glintquery N+1 remediation, we replaced the per-row resolver calls with a batched loader against the Orchardmap service. Since the old resolver leaked its credential into debug traces, we are rotating the affected key effective this Thursday. Reviewers approving the batching PR should confirm the loader reads the new credential from config, not the deprecated constant. For staging verification, the replacement key is provided immediately below this message.

gateway credential: kto3_qfe

## Formula Sandbox — Limits

User-supplied formulas in Mossvale Sheets run inside the Pindrop interpreter. No I/O, no reflection, no recursion past the fixed depth. Violations abort evaluation and log to the audit stream. Review changes to any limit with the sandbox owners; loosening them widens the abuse surface. Current enforced limits are as follows.

constants for tageg-kagag:
QUOTAS = {
    "kelax": 495,
    "istath": 366,
    "tammir": 108,
    "novdor": 730,
    "casax": 816,
    "quenael": 874,
    "pelius": 403,
}

Hey Marla,

Quick handover before I head out. The six returned demo units from the Brellix roadshow came back this morning — four tablets and two of the Voxen scanners. I've logged them on the returns shelf near bay 3, all boxed and taped. The scanners still have client stickers on them, so don't restock those until Devan has wiped them. A courier from Quillhart Logistics is booked to collect the whole lot tomorrow before noon. For the pickup itself, follow the hand-over instruction below.

courier memo of hafop-bagep: the pelwyn quenys courier leaves the casir oliwyn casix weniel jorwyn ralwyn briix isteth ledger at gate 3637 under passcode 492304